Introduction: Singapore has become a vibrant hub for tech startups and innovators from all around the world. With its thriving business ecosystem, supportive government policies, and top-notch infrastructure, Singapore has emerged as an attractive destination for UK-based tech startups and innovators looking to expand their operations. In this blog post, we will explore how Singapore's properties and facilities have contributed to the growth of the tech sector, specifically for UK entrepreneurs. Why Singapore? 1. Access to Global Markets: Singapore's strategic location acts as a gateway to the Asian market, providing UK startups with the opportunity to expand their reach beyond local boundaries. With a robust infrastructure, efficient logistics, and excellent connectivity, Singapore serves as an ideal launchpad for UK-based tech companies to tap into the rapidly growing Asian consumer base. 2. Supportive Business Environment: Singapore offers a business-friendly environment, making it easy for tech startups and innovators to establish and grow their operations. The government's initiatives, such as grants and tax incentives, encourage entrepreneurs to set up their base in Singapore. They also provide mentorship programs and networking platforms to connect startups with potential investors, industry experts, and talent. 3. Dynamic Startup Ecosystem: Singapore boasts a thriving startup ecosystem that nurtures innovation and collaboration. The city-state is home to numerous co-working spaces, incubators, and accelerators, providing tech startups with the resources and support needed to thrive. These facilities often come equipped with state-of-the-art amenities and cutting-edge technology, enabling startups to work in a conducive environment. Singapore Properties for Tech Startups and Innovators: 1. Co-Working Spaces: Singapore offers a wide range of co-working spaces tailored specifically for tech startups and innovators. These spaces foster collaboration, creativity, and networking opportunities among like-minded individuals. Some prominent co-working spaces in Singapore include WeWork, The Working Capitol, and The Hive. 2. Incubators and Accelerators: Incubators and accelerators play a crucial role in nurturing early-stage startups and helping them grow rapidly. Singapore hosts a number of renowned incubators and accelerators, including JFDI.Asia, BLOCK71, and Entrepreneur First, which provide startups with mentorship, funding, and a supportive community to accelerate their growth. 3. Tech Parks and Innovation Hubs: Singapore is home to several tech parks and innovation hubs, which serve as a focal point for tech startups and innovators. Locations such as one-north, JTC Launchpad, and Mapletree Business City offer cutting-edge infrastructure, research facilities, and collaborative spaces, creating an ideal ecosystem for tech-driven companies.
